Windscribe review for crypto users

Last reviewed 2026-08-26

No service on this page has been tested as often, or as involuntarily, as Windscribe. Three separate authorities have come looking, and the record of what they found is the review.

Ukrainian authorities seized two servers in July 2021. No user activity logs existed, but the machines were not encrypted at rest and an OpenVPN certificate authority key was exposed. Windscribe published the failure itself, in technical detail, and rebuilt the entire network onto RAM-only servers in a programme it called Operation FreshScribe. In April 2025 a Greek court dismissed criminal charges brought against co-founder Yegor Sak personally, with INTERPOL involvement, after a two-year case in which Windscribe had no user data to produce. In February 2026 Dutch authorities physically took a server from a rack and, by the company's account, found a stock install running entirely in memory with no drives and no logs.

PacketLabs audited the rebuilt infrastructure in 2024 across twenty repositories and roughly eighty thousand lines of code, and Leviathan Security audited the desktop apps in 2021 and the mobile apps in 2022. The apps are open source.

Windscribe markets itself directly at crypto traders, naming Coinbase among others on its own pages, and its framing there is more honest than most: it tells readers a VPN cannot anonymise a KYC-verified account, and advises against using one to reach a restricted region. Signup needs no email at all, payment takes bitcoin including over Lightning, and the free tier gives 10 GB a month with a confirmed email or 2 GB without. Canada is a Five Eyes member, which the company addresses directly rather than hiding.

The evidence for the no-logs claim

A no-logs policy is a sentence on a website until someone checks. This is what has actually been checked for Windscribe, dated, with the primary source for each item.

Independent audits

  • 2024

    PacketLabs: the full FreshScribe server infrastructure, 20 repositories and roughly 80,000 lines of code, with external and internal penetration testing. source

  • 2022

    Leviathan Security Group: security audit of the mobile applications. source

  • 2021

    Leviathan Security Group: security audit of the desktop applications. source

Tested in the real world

  • 2026

    Dutch authorities physically seized a Windscribe server from a data centre rack. The company reports they found a stock install running entirely in RAM, with no drives, logs or user data on it. source

  • 2025

    Greek prosecutors, with INTERPOL involvement, charged co-founder Yegor Sak personally over activity traced to a Windscribe server. The case was dismissed on 11 April 2025 after a two-year fight, because Windscribe held no user data to produce. source

  • 2021

    Ukrainian authorities seized two Windscribe servers. No user activity logs were found, but the unencrypted disks exposed an OpenVPN certificate authority key; Windscribe disclosed this publicly and rebuilt its network to run only in RAM. source

Incidents

  • 2021

    The two servers seized in Ukraine were not encrypted at rest, exposing an OpenVPN certificate authority key that could in principle have supported an interception attack against traffic on those servers. source

No email address is required to create or use an account; supplying one is optional and only raises the free-tier cap from 2 GB to 10 GB a month.

The refund sentence that governs a crypto purchase, from Windscribe's own policy:

Crypto refunds are only available for payments over $10 USD. However, we only offer crypto refunds with Bitcoin, not the original currency you use for payment. refund policy

What it will not do: bypass KYC, hide on-chain activity, or make a geo-blocked exchange usable. Presenting a false location to an exchange breaches its terms of service and is how accounts get frozen with the balance inside. Details in the VPN guide.

Frequently asked questions

Does Windscribe require an email address?

No. An account can be created and used without one. Supplying an email is optional and only raises the free tier from 2 GB to 10 GB a month.

What happened when Windscribe's servers were seized?

Ukrainian authorities took two servers in 2021 and found no activity logs, though the unencrypted disks exposed a certificate key. Windscribe disclosed it and rebuilt onto RAM-only servers; when Dutch authorities seized a server in 2026, it reports they found nothing.

Windscribe markets itself for crypto trading. Does a VPN help there?

It encrypts the connection between you and an exchange and hides your IP from the local network. Windscribe's own pages say plainly that it cannot anonymise a KYC-verified account and advise against using it to reach a restricted region, which matches the terms of most exchanges.

Can I get a refund on a crypto payment?

Only for payments over $10, only within seven business days, only while usage stays under 10 GB, and the refund is paid in bitcoin whatever coin you originally sent.
